This article examines question-response interactions between a professor and his teaching assistant (TA) in an academic setting. Drawing upon conversation analysis (CA), this study aims to explore some problematic interactions during their communication and the negotiation sequence used to resolve the problems. A close examination of the data reveals that both of the participants are engaged in resolving the problematic interactions. Either modifying or suspending a current troublesome question is proved to be effective in solving the communicative problems. Both the professor and the TA have the tendency of confirming information before uttering a response when they are less confident to provide an answer. And the professor, rather than the TA, has the characteristic of continuously checking information during the interactions, which is regarded as a helpful tactic to prevent a problematic interaction from occurring. The findings may have an implication for enhancing the communicative competence in an academic setting.
